Amrock completes eClosing in North Carolina
Posted Date: Tuesday, July 31, 2018
The nation’s largest independent provider of title insurance, valuations and settlement services recently completed its first eClosing in North Carolina.
Using Pavaso’s digital platform, the mortgage closing also was the first by Amrock that used In-Person Electronic Notarization (IPEN).

Blockchain property deal completed in California
Posted Date: Friday, July 27, 2018
The global real estate entity Propy announced the recent completion of the first comprehensive, Blockchain-recorded property deal in California.
A Realtor represented both the buyer and the seller, and the buyer used Bitcoin to pay for 10 acres of vacant land in Kern County, Calif.

DataTrace to manage Central Texas title plants
Posted Date: Thursday, July 26, 2018
DataTrace Information Services LLC has signed a 10-year agreement to host and manage Austin Data, Inc.’s title plants in Central Texas, the companies announced.
Austin Data’s title plants are located in the Texas counties of Travis, Williamson, Hays, Bastrop, Caldwell, Burnet and Llano.
